Warnihal Population - Gulbarga, Karnataka

Warnihal is a medium size village located in Gulbarga Taluka of Gulbarga district, Karnataka with total 329 families residing. The Warnihal village has population of 1928 of which 1036 are males while 892 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Warnihal village population of children with age 0-6 is 305 which makes up 15.82 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Warnihal village is 861 which is lower than Karnataka state average of 973. Child Sex Ratio for the Warnihal as per census is 860, lower than Karnataka average of 948.

Warnihal village has lower literacy rate compared to Karnataka. In 2011, literacy rate of Warnihal village was 53.36 % compared to 75.36 % of Karnataka. In Warnihal Male literacy stands at 66.06 % while female literacy rate was 38.62 %.

Caste Factor

In Warnihal village, most of the villagers are from Schedule Caste (SC).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 72.56 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.05 % of total population in Warnihal village.

Work Profile

In Warnihal village out of total population, 883 were engaged in work activities. 54.02 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 45.98 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 883 workers engaged in Main Work, 205 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 153 were Agricultural labourer.
